Located in the Hawaii Department Of Education at 2100 Hookiekie St in Pearl City, HI, Pearl City High School serves grades 9-12 & ungraded and has an enrollment of roughly 1799 students. What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Pearl City c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Pearl City range from $1,995 to $2,800.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,245.
